The international group of scientists discovered perforated substances (PFA) at high concentrations in the North Pole ecosystems. These permanent chemicals used in the industry accumulate in the organisms of people who eat traditional foods and even traditional food. The study was published scientifically magazine Total Environmental Science (STE).
PFAs, which are used in the production of anti -structural dishes, are transferred to the North Pole by water fresh and fire foam, air and water flows. Here, in animal organisms and traditional foods – they accumulate in the bodies of indigenous peoples.
“The North Pole is a global pollution mirror. It reflects the scale of the problem here,” said Professor, the joint author of the study, fell from the University of Faroe Islands to Vaiche.
According to experts, PFAs at the discovered concentrations disrupt reproductive functions, weaken immunity and cause hormonal faults in animals.
In humans, these substances increase the risk of thyroid cancer, liver damage and other disease. Native peoples who consume the meat of marine mammals are at a special risk.
